In honor of Cade's first year of life, I thought it would be appropriate to share a few things that I have learned this year:

1. You never realize how much you can love another person at first meeting until you see your baby for the first time. It brings true meaning to "love at first sight."

2. Poop on my hands, puke in my hair or pee on my shirt do not bother me near as much as I thought they would.

3. I may never sleep well again, but have realized that I can function on less sleep than I originally thought possible...

4. I never thought I would be a stay at home mom- and now I wouldn't trade it for anything!

5. No matter how bad of a day or night you have, a smile from your baby will make it all better.

6. I spend more on Cade's clothes than my own:) I figure people are more interested in seeing him anyway!

7. Your parents are done with you now. It is all about the grandkids now! ha ha!

8. Boys will be boys, no matter what age they are!

9. Boys LOVE their mamas:)

10. No matter how many times you hear that they grow up so fast, you never truly understand it until you have your own.
